Documenting Maritime Heritage Resources in Rhode Island

Rhode Island, with its extensive coastline and rich maritime history, faces specific challenges in the preservation of unpublished research materials related to this heritage. As one of the smallest states, Rhode Island has a significant number of historical maritime sites and unique seafaring stories. However, rising sea levels and the impacts of climate change threaten these resources, necessitating urgent funding for their preservation and enhancement of public access.

The individuals and organizations affected by the insufficient preservation funding include maritime historians, scholars of nautical archaeology, and local museums dedicated to preserving Rhode Island's rich maritime legacy. Senior scholars often hold unpublished research that documents the lives of seafarers and the state's maritime economy. Without adequate funding to preserve and archive these materials, vital narratives that contribute to Rhode Island's cultural identity remain at risk of being forgotten.

The grant program specifically aims to support the preservation of unpublished research materials by providing financial assistance to scholars and historical organizations focused on this unique aspect of Rhode Island's heritage. This initiative promotes collaboration with local maritime museums to archive field research and oral accounts of seafaring life, thus ensuring these stories are documented and accessible for future generations.

For Rhode Island, preserving maritime heritage is an essential endeavor, as it informs contemporary discussions around climate resilience and heritage conservation. Documenting the maritime past is crucial for developing informed policies that address both environmental challenges and community identity. By providing funding for preservation efforts, the initiative not only safeguards important historical resources but also enhances the educational landscape regarding maritime history in Rhode Island.
